What is the quadratic equation if the solutions are -9+ √65 /2, -9- √65 /2

Mathematics
1 answer:
liberstina [14]3 years ago
4 0

Answer:

4x^2+72x+259=0

Step-by-step explanation:

If x_1 and x_2 are the solutions to the quadratic equation, then this equation can be written as

(x-x_1)(x-x_2)=0

In your case,

x_1=-9+\dfrac{\sqrt{65}}{2}\\ \\x_1=-9-\dfrac{\sqrt{65}}{2}

Then the equation is

\left(x-\left(-9+\dfrac{\sqrt{65}}{2}\right)\right) \left(x-\left(-9-\dfrac{\sqrt{65}}{2}\right)\right)=0\\ \\\left(x+9-\dfrac{\sqrt{65}}{2}\right)\left(x+9+\dfrac{\sqrt{65}}{2}\right)=0\\ \\x^2+9x+\dfrac{\sqrt{65}}{2}x+9x+81+\dfrac{9\sqrt{65}}{2}-\dfrac{\sqrt{65}}{2}x-\dfrac{9\sqrt{65}}{2}-\dfrac{65}{4}=0\\ \\x^2+18x+\dfrac{259}{4}=0\\ \\4x^2+72x+259=0

Match each of the parametric equations 1-5 with the curve it represents from the list A through E below. 1. r=3 2. r=2sinθ 3. θ=
ira [324]

Answer:

Step-by-step explanation:

1. r=3

To convert from polar coordinates (r,θ) to rectangular coordinates (x,y), we use the following equations

x=rCosθ

Cosθ=x/r

y=rSinθ

Sinθ=y/r

Also, r²=x²+y²

When r =3,

Then we have

r=3,

x²+y²=3

All points with r = 3 are at

distance 3 from the origin, so r = 3 describes the circle of radius 3, with center at the origin (0,0).

Option C

2. r=2sinθ

When r=2sinθ

To convert from polar coordinates (r,θ) to rectangular coordinates (x,y), we use the following equations

x=rCosθ

Cosθ=x/r

y=rSinθ

Sinθ=y/r

Also, r²=x²+y²

Now, apply the given information

r=2sinθ

Since Sinθ=y/r

r=2y/r

Cross multiply

r²=2y

x²+y²=2y

x²+y²-2y =0

x²+ (y-1)² -1 =0

x²+(y-1)²=1²

Then,

It is a circle with center (0,1) and radius 1.

Because the sine is periodic, we know that we will get the entire curve for values of θ in [0, 2π). As θ runs from 0 to π/2, r increases

from 0 to 2. Then as θ continues to π, r decreases again to 0. When θ runs from π to

2π, r is negative, and it is not hard to see that the first part of the curve is simply traced

out again, so in fact we get the whole curve for values of θ in [0, π). Thus, check attachment for curve, Now, this suggests that the curve could possibly be a circle,

and if it is, it would have to be the circle x² + (y − 1)² = 1. Having made this guess, we can easily check it. First we substitute for x and y to get (r cos θ)² + (r sin θ − 1)² = 1;

expanding and simplifying does indeed turn this into r = 2 sin θ.

Option E
